MT4での話。
ここんところ、仕事でMTを触ってて問題解決ができたので備忘用に。
カテゴリごとに出力内容を分けるのに頻出するのが<MTifCategory label="hoge">ですが、子を持つ親カテゴリに対しては、どうやら効かないみたいです。
で、試行錯誤の末、効果を発揮するのは<MTIfIsDescendant parent="hoge">だということがわかりました。
これは、親カテゴリが"hoge"という名前のときに、</MTIfIsDescendant>までの間に書いた内容を処理して出力してくれるものです。
≪まとめ≫
子がいないカテゴリに対する条件一致処理の場合は、
<MTifCategory label="hoge">
:
</MTifCategory>
子を持つカテゴリに対する条件一致処理の場合は、
<MTIfIsDescendant parent="hoge">
:
</MTIfIsDescendant>
はじめまして
ありがとうございました
仕事で子カテゴリのある
個別ページにカテゴリごとに
アクセス解析を入れなくてはならず、
試行錯誤していたところこちらにたどり着き実現できました
投稿情報: hiroe | 2009/05/18 17:10
hiroe様。
。
お役に立てたようでうれしいです
コメントありがとうございました。
投稿情報: CATOjun | 2009/05/18 19:40